What Is Sleep Apnea and How Does It Work?
Sleep apnea is a problem in which your breathing consistently quits and starts while you're asleep. These stops briefly can last simply a few secs or stretch to a min or more, happening dozens and even thousands of times a night. Your mind senses the absence of oxygen and briefly wakes you up so that typical breathing can return to. Typically, these awakenings are so brief that you do not remember them. But the result is an evening of fragmented, poor-quality rest that leaves you feeling drained the next day.
There are different types of rest apnea, with one of the most common being obstructive sleep apnea. This occurs when the muscles in the back of your throat fail to keep your air passage open. Central rest apnea, though much less usual, involves the brain failing to send the appropriate signals to the muscle mass that regulate breathing.
Refined Signs That Point to a Bigger Problem
Among the trickiest features of sleep apnea is how simple it is to miss. Lots of people think about loud snoring as the primary signs and symptom, and while snoring is common, it's far from the only warning sign. As a matter of fact, some people with sleep apnea do not snore in all. That's why it's so important to take note of the much more refined indicators that your body could be providing you.
Getting up with a dry mouth or sore throat, early morning migraines, and feeling excessively drowsy throughout the day are all signals that something may be off. If you find yourself nodding off throughout job conferences, at the wheel, or even while watching television, maybe a sign that your rest is being disrupted more often than you assume.
You may also notice state of mind changes, trouble focusing, or a short temper. These symptoms are often written off as the outcome of anxiety or a busy timetable, however persistent sleep starvation triggered by rest apnea can take a genuine toll on your psychological health.
Just how It Affects Your Body Beyond Sleep
The repercussions of untreated rest apnea go far past daytime sleepiness. With time, this condition can cause serious health and wellness issues. Interrupted breathing emphasizes the cardiovascular system and has been connected to hypertension, heart disease, stroke, and even kind 2 diabetes mellitus. It can also deteriorate the body immune system, making you extra at risk to illness and slower to recuperate.

When to Take Action and What to Expect
So, when should you take that suspicion seriously and speak with a specialist? If any one of the symptoms defined over sound acquainted, it's worth having a conversation with a specialist. A sleep research-- either at a center or in the comfort of your home-- can assist identify if rest apnea is the reason for your fatigue.
Treatment options vary based upon the seriousness of the problem. Some people gain from lifestyle modifications, such as slimming down or adjusting sleep placements. Others may need even more organized interventions, such as oral devices or continuous positive respiratory tract pressure (CPAP) therapy to keep the respiratory tract open throughout sleep. It's not a one-size-fits-all circumstance, and locating the right option can significantly improve quality of life.
